Hockey bettors look for value at United Center on Tuesday as host Chicago battles the Colorado Avalanche in hockey odds action.

The Blackhawks bring a 30-8-10 record to the battle against the 28-12-5 Avalanche. OVER/UNDER bettors have seen Chicago go 26-22 so far and the Avalanche go 21-22-2.

Sportsbooks such as Sportsbook had the Blackhawks as -200 moneyline Favorite in this particular NHL matchup earlier. The total, meanwhile, was set early at 5.5 before betting started to move the line at Sportsbook.

The NHL Power Rankings show a disparity between these teams, with the Blackhawks rated this week at No. 1 and the Avalanche sitting at No. 17.



Colorado won its last outing, a 4-2 result against the Wild on January 11. Bettors who backed the Avalanche at +105 on the moneyline won on the day, and the total score (6) sent OVER bettors to the payout window.

How They Match Up:
The game also pits Chicago's No. 2-ranked offense, averaging 3.65 goals per game, against a Avalanche defense that ranks No. 12 at 2.56 goals allowed. The Blackhawks power play is averaging 24.18% while the Avalanche defense kills off 80.74% of their penalties.
